After creating your spatial intelligence solution, you can select and configure the application services within the solution.

This topic describes how to select application services, the first step of solution configuration.

After creating a solution, you will be automatically directed to the Select Applications page. This page shows all available microapps under the service suite, allowing you to manage the application services all in one place.

Before making a selection, you can click App Details to know more about a specific application service.

You can filter the required microapps based on app types, functional properties, or scenarios. You can also freely combine and select both web and mobile apps. Select apps according to your project’s implementation scenario and actual requirements. On completion, click Save.

To add more apps, click Add App in the upper right corner of the page and select as needed.

  • If you select both web and mobile apps, the system will automatically configure cross-platform capabilities.
  • If the existing capabilities cannot meet your needs, you can also opt for custom development.

Switch between data centers

A single solution can be deployed in multiple data centers. You can select the desired data centers to configure data based on the country or region. Switch between data centers to configure the capabilities of each data center separately.

Next step

After selecting the apps, click Next Step Configure System at the bottom of the page to proceed with the initial system configuration. For detailed steps, refer to Configure System.
